 Econoline Crush http://www.econolinecrush.ca/

Econoline Crush are a Vancouver based alternative band formed in 1992. They recorded a string of mid 1990’s, and 2000's hits including You Don”t Know What It’s Like,”“Sparkle and Shine,” “Home,” “Surefire,” “Get Out of the Way,” and “Make It Right.”

BIO

Jesse Roads

Jesse was born in the city of Lethbridge and raised to his teen years in the southern Alberta farming community of Raymond. Jesse's early inspirations include the hypnotic sounds of big-name artists such as Jimi Hendrix, The Black Crowes, City and Colour, Jack Johnson, Guns 'N' Roses, and Pink Floyd. Jesse is a rocker who has done his fair share of "paying his dues" opening and touring with such acts as: Carson Cole, Clayton Bellamy (of The Road Hammers), Tupelo Honey, Retrograde, The Smalls, and Mcquaig to name just a few.

From 2003 to 2006, Jesse had the pleasure of fronting southern Alberta's own hard rock trio "affliction" and received many notable reviews, toured Canada, and received radio airplay throughout Alberta and British Columbia.

The Jesse Roads Band is the latest branch of Jesse's creative tree. The JRB captures the high energy blues rock show that Jesse has spent years crafting.

In 2009-2010 Jesse held an impressive 85 week residence at Steeps Tea Lounge on Whyte Avenue in Edmonton, AB where he hosted an Acoustic Showcase. After a brief hiatus the showcase resumed in September 2011.
